MADISON, Wis. — The World Dairy Show Expo results have recently been announced. Here are some of the top winners.

Top five countries of registered international attendance: Canada, Japan, Mexico, Germany and Brazil.

Commercial Exhibitors

There were 843 companies from 29 countries, 43 U.S. states and six Canadian provinces. The large booth winner was supreme international limited; the intermediate booth winner was Semex; the small booth winner was Double S Liquid Feed Services.

Breeds exhibited

There were seven dairy breeds exhibited. There were 2,225 head of dairy cattle checked in, including 229 Ayrshires, 361 brown Swiss, 203 Guernseys, 617 Holsteins, 371 Jerseys, 191 milking shorthorns, and 253 red and whites.

There were 1,616 exhibitors from 36 states and seven Canadian provinces.

Total Numbers of Sale Lots: Ayrshire, 14; Brown Swiss, 27; Guernsey, eight; Holstein, 48; Jersey, 33.

International Guernsey Classic:

Total Sales: $28,912
Lots: Eight
Average on live animals: $3,614
Highest Lot: $6,700 for Misty Meadows HP Fame Pixar to P. Morey Miller, Mike Hellenbrand and Peter Vail, Granby, Conn., consigned by Randy Peterson & Hillpoint, Cross Plains, Wis.

Top of the World Jersey Sale
Total Sales: $84,550
Lots: 33
Average: $2,562
Highest Lot: $10,100 for Faria Brothers Marvel Maradona, purchased by Sexing Technologies, Wis., consigned by Faria Brothers Dairy, Dumas, Texas.

World Ayrshire Event
Total Sales: $42,350
Lots: 14
Average: $3,028
Highest Lot: $6,800 for De La Plaine Dreamer Sterling-ET, purchased by Tyler Boyer & Monica Streff, Clintonville, Wis., consigned by Ferme De La Plaine, Beaconcour, Quebec.

World Classic 2013 Holstein Sale
Total Sales: $1,264,600
Lots: 48
Average: $26,262.50
Highest Lot: $131,000 for Oconnors Aikman Scarlet-Red, purchased by Scarlet Syndicate c/o Patty Jones, Ontario, consigned by Mapelwood, O’Connor and GenerVations, Jerseyville, Ontario

World Premier Brown Swiss Sale
Total Sales: $120,690
Lots: 27
Average: $4,470
Highest Lot: $9,000 for Blessing Bonanza Floris, purchased by Rex Morts, Pierceton, Ind., consigned by Blessing Farms, Fort Wayne, Ind.

Supreme Champion of World Dairy Expo
Supreme Champion Cow: Bonaccueil Maya Goldwyn
Exhibited by: Ty-D Holsteins, Drolet & Fils, Ferme Jacobs, A. & R. Boulet Inc, Cap-Sante, Quebec

Reserve Supreme Champion Cow: KHW Regiment Apple-3-Red-ETN
Exhibited by: Westcoast Holsteins, Chilliwack, British Columbia

Supreme Champion Cow of the Junior Show: Willdina Jade Bee
Exhibited by: Nic, Jeni, Ben & Andy Sauder, Tremont, Ill.

Reserve Supreme Champion Cow of the Junior Show: Cleland Advent Korie-Red-ET

Exhibited by: J, Z, J & D Stransky and Ryan Lauber, Owatonna, Minn.

International Ayrshire Show Results

Grand Champion Female: Sunny Acres TSB Silk
Exhibited by: Gregory W.B. Evans, Georgetown, N.Y. Reserve Grand Champion Female: Melody-Lane Burdette Sally Exhibited by Kaylyn Wood, Saranac, N.Y.

Grand Champion Female of the Junior Show: Four-Hills Abush Sammy
Exhibited by: Britney & Bradley Hill, Bristol, Vt.

Reserve Grand and Champion Female of the Junior Show: Spring Vale Burdt Applefritter
Exhibited by: Jeffrey Hubbard Jr., Thurmont, Md.

Premier Breeder: Daltondale Farms, John Dalton, Hartland, Wis. Premier
Exhibitor: Old Bankston, Epworth, Iowa Premier Sire: Palmyra Tri-Star Burdette-ET

International Brown Swiss Show Results

Grand Champion Female: Cutting Edge B Gretchen-ET
Exhibited by: Ken Main & Peter Vail, Copake, N.Y.

Reserve Grand Champion Female: Top Acres Supreme Wizard-ET
Exhibited by: Wayne E. Sliker, St. Paris, Ohio

Grand Champion Female of the Junior Show: Fairdale Elite Debra
Exhibited by: Michael Barton, Copake, N.Y.

Reserve Grand Champion Female of the Junior Show: SCF Mayers Jetway Vixen-ET
Exhibited by: Dylan Mayer, Slinger, Wis.

Premier Breeder: Random Luck, Richard Thompson, Darlington, Wis.
Premier Exhibitor: Ken Main & Peter Vail, Elite Dairy, Copake, N.Y.
Premier Sire: Old Mill WDE Supreme-ET

International Guernsey Show Results

Grand Champion Female: Wee Acres Spider Clara Bell
Exhibited by: Cara Woloohojian, West Greenwich, R.I.

Reserve Grand Champion Female: Millborne Hillpoint S Fiesta-ET
Exhibited by: P. Morey Miller, Mike Hellenbrand and Peter Vail, Granby, Vt.

Grand Champion Female of the Junior Show: Wee Acres Spider Clara Bell
Exhibited by: Cara Woloohojian, West Greenwich, R.I.

Reserve Grand Champion Female of the Junior Show: Knapps Regis Tambouine-ET
Exhibited by: Austin & Landen Knapp, Epworth, Iowa

Premier Breeder: Austin & Landen Knapp, Epworth, Iowa
Premier Exhibitor: Austin & Landen Knapp, Epworth, Iowa Premier Sire: Sniders Option Aaron-ET

International Holstein Show Results

Grand and Senior Champion Female: Bonaccueil Maya Goldwyn
Exhibited by: Ty-D Holsteins, Drolet & Fils, Ferme Jacobs, A. & R. Boulet Inc, Cap-Sante, Quebec

Reserve Grand and Reserve Senior Champion Female: Cookview Goldwyn Monique
Exhibited by: Jeff Butler, Joe & Amber Price, Chebanse, Ill.

Grand Champion Female of the Junior Show: Whitaker-KK Goldie Rose Exhibited by Rachel Friese & Genavieve Knaup, Wanamingo, Minn. Reserve Grand Champion Female of the Junior Show: Sunrose Jess
Exhibited by: Bryce & Brant Gingerich & Riley Treat, Millersburg, Ind.
